What is a DevOps engineer and is it a good field to get into?

In the ever-evolving landscape of technology, the role of a DevOps engineer has emerged as a crucial and indispensable one. DevOps, derived from the combination of Development and Operations, is a set of practices, principles, and cultural philosophies that enhance an organization’s ability to deliver applications and services at high velocity. DevOps engineers play a pivotal role in bridging the gap between development and IT operations. They are responsible for automating and streamlining the processes of software development and IT operations to improve collaboration and productivity within an organization.

What Does a DevOps Engineer Do?

DevOps engineers are skilled professionals who possess expertise in both software development and IT operations. They collaborate with developers, system operators, and other IT staff members to manage code releases. DevOps engineers automate and optimize the processes involved in code testing, integration, deployment, and monitoring. By implementing DevOps practices, organizations can achieve faster development cycles, reduced deployment failures, and shortened lead times between fixes.

Key Responsibilities of a DevOps Engineer:

  1. Continuous Integration (CI): DevOps engineers ensure that code changes are automatically built, tested, and integrated into the shared repository on a regular basis.
  2. Continuous Deployment (CD): They automate the process of deploying code changes to production and other environments, ensuring a seamless and reliable delivery pipeline.
  3. Infrastructure as Code (IaC): DevOps engineers use IaC tools to manage and provision infrastructure through code, enabling faster and consistent environment setup.
  4. Monitoring and Logging: They implement robust monitoring and logging solutions to track application performance, detect issues, and facilitate quick resolution.
  5. Collaboration and Communication: DevOps engineers promote a culture of collaboration and communication between development and operations teams, breaking down silos and fostering teamwork.

Benefits of Pursuing a Career in DevOps:

  1. High Demand: Organizations worldwide are actively seeking skilled DevOps professionals, leading to a high demand for certified engineers.
  2. Lucrative Salaries: DevOps engineers enjoy competitive salaries and attractive perks due to their specialized skill set.
  3. Continuous Learning: DevOps is a dynamic field, offering continuous learning opportunities to stay updated with the latest tools and technologies.
  4. Cross-Functional Skills: DevOps professionals acquire a diverse skill set, making them valuable assets across various domains and industries.
  5. Job Satisfaction: DevOps engineers play a pivotal role in improving software development and deployment processes, leading to a sense of accomplishment and job satisfaction.
